About 446 Glendale Dr

Charming Old Metairie home built in 1950 with a fabulous two story addition added to the rear of the home in 1997. Lots of entertaining alternatives with formal Living areas, new addition with Dining & vaulted ceiling Den with fireplace. French doors to expansive backyard lawn (room for a pool) and patio. Four to five bedrooms with Primary suite and office on second floor -- three additional bedrooms on first floor -- one ensuite first floor bedroom could be used as Primary Bedroom. Freshly painted interior, stucco exterior and off-street parking driveway for 2 cars. Located in the heart of Old Metairie, Pontiff Playground, St. Catherine, and dining/shopping along Metairie Road. This home is welcoming for a growing family!

Living in Metairie, LA

Transportation options in Metairie include a network of major roads and highways that facilitate travel and commuting to nearby New Orleans and other areas. Public transit is available, with bus services providing connections to key destinations. The community is also bike-friendly, with several designated bike paths. While ride-sharing services are operational in the area, specific brands are not mentioned. The walkability can vary across different parts of Metairie, with some neighborhoods being more pedestrian-friendly than others.

The community is served by a solid educational system, including a variety of public and private schools that cater to different educational needs. Healthcare services are readily available, with several clinics and a major hospital that offers a range of medical services. Metairie also features a public library system that supports the community's educational and informational needs. The retail and dining scene is reflective of the local culture, with a mix of national chains and local establishments that cater to a variety of tastes and preferences.

Metairie is known for its suburban feel with a strong sense of community. The area prides itself on its family-friendly atmosphere and is celebrated for events like the annual Family Gras festival, which showcases local music and culture. The community's character is also defined by its numerous parks and recreational areas, providing residents with ample green space and outdoor activities.

Metairie's housing market is diverse, offering a range of options from single-family homes to multi-family complexes. The architectural styles vary, with a mix of traditional, ranch-style, and contemporary homes. A significant portion of the housing stock dates back to the mid-20th century, reflecting the area's growth during that period. The homeownership rate in Metairie is robust, with a majority of residents owning their homes, while a smaller percentage are renters.
